Your firm has an average collection period of 42 days. Current practice is to factor all receivables immediately at a 4 percent discount. Assume that default is extremely unlikely. What is the effective cost of borrowing? 
 
A. 
28.79 percent

B. 
36.20 percent

C. 
37.78 percent

D. 
40.97 percent

E. 
42.58 percent
Number of periods = 365/42 = 8.6905
EAR = {1 + [0.04/(1 - 0.04)]8.6905 - 1 = 42.58 percent
